Where he stands

Matt Brown is 5-7 across 12 fights on our tape. Our rating has him at 1465 — it moves with every result and weights who he beat, so a win over a ranked opponent counts for far more than one over a debutant. A record on its own says very little in this sport — two fighters at 12-3 can have faced completely different opposition, which is exactly the gap the rating is built to close.

He ends fights

100% of Matt's wins have come inside the distance. That's a real trait and a volatile one: a finisher's floor is lower than his highlight reel suggests, because the same aggression that ends fights early loses them early. He absorbs 3.7 significant strikes a minute, which is the number to watch — a high finish rate paired with heavy absorption is a career that tends to be short and loud.

Age matters more here than in most sports

Matt is 45. MMA decline tends to arrive suddenly rather than gradually — durability goes before output does, so a fighter can look sharp on the stats right up until he doesn't. The model factors age in, and it's one of the places we'd trust the number least on any individual fight.

Fight history

DateOpponentResultEventΔ rating
May 13, 2023Court McGeeW · KO/TKO R1UFC Fight Night: Rozenstruik vs. Almeida+20
Mar 26, 2022Bryan BarberenaL · Decision - Split R3UFC Fight Night: Blaydes vs. Daukaus-11
Jun 19, 2021Dhiego LimaW · KO/TKO R2UFC Fight Night: The Korean Zombie vs. Ige+20
Jan 16, 2021Carlos ConditL · Decision - Unanimous R3UFC Fight Night: Holloway vs. Kattar-17
May 16, 2020Miguel BaezaL · KO/TKO R2UFC Fight Night: Overeem vs. Harris-14
Dec 15, 2019Ben SaundersW · KO/TKO R2UFC 245: Usman vs. Covington+18
Nov 12, 2017Diego SanchezW · KO/TKO R1UFC Fight Night: Poirier vs. Pettis+21
Dec 11, 2016Donald CerroneL · KO/TKO R3UFC 206: Holloway vs. Pettis-20
Jul 31, 2016Jake EllenbergerL · KO/TKO R1UFC 201: Lawler vs. Woodley-41
May 14, 2016Demian MaiaL · Submission R3UFC 198: Werdum vs. Miocic-29
Jul 11, 2015Tim MeansW · Submission R1UFC 189: Mendes vs. McGregor+50
Mar 14, 2015Johny HendricksL · Decision - Unanimous R3UFC 185: Pettis vs. dos Anjos-32
